Left 4 Dead 2 Scavenge Mode Screens & Gameplay Footage

WorthPlaying writes: "L4D2 promises to set a new benchmark for co-operative action games, adding melee combat to enable deeper co-operative gameplay, with items such as a chainsaw, frying pan, axe, baseball bat, and more.Scavenge mode pits humans vs. various infected, with the human team retrieving as many of the 16 gas cans to fill up generators within 90 seconds. Each successful usage adds 20 seconds to the clock, and players switch sides after three rounds. The team that wins the most games is victorious."
